Output 908588317cc34b75814fadf61d229543ab2b231e6622b4d6ba2199cc731eb9e0:47

value
15898
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 32f885f0497ef3550bec34b36af84f4b994f8beeedee3248541c1802c52b0146
address
bc1pxtugtuzf0me42zlvxjek47z0fwv5lzlwahhryjz5rsvq93ftq9rqmd6qc2
transaction
908588317cc34b75814fadf61d229543ab2b231e6622b4d6ba2199cc731eb9e0
spent
true